Inhibition of Myeloid-Derived Suppressor Cell Arginase-1 Production Enhances T-Cell-Based Immunotherapy against Cryptococcus neoformans Infection

0
300
Researchers showed that glucuronoxylomannan, the major polysaccharide component of C. neoformans, induced the recruitment of neutrophilic myeloid-derived suppressor cells in mice and patients with cryptococcosis.
